Liverpool have impressed so far this season, and up until Chelsea put on a masterclass over the weekend – they were leading the Premier League.
Jurgen Klopp has led his side fantastically so far this season, but it appears clear that his side is in desperate need of a bit of defensive reinforcement.
It would make sense, then, that Klopp would be looking towards expanding his squad depth in January, and if the Daily Star are to be believed – that is exactly what he is planning to do.
According to the Daily Star, Jurgen Klopp is plotting a Southampton double-swoop – with both Sam McQueen and Virgil van Dijk on his radar.
Whilst naturally a midfielder, Sam McQueen has been utilised on the left-hand side of the defence for Southampton this season – and has looked good in doing so.
Virgil van Dijk is, undoubtedly, the more high profile of the two – and the Liverpool fans in the Football Transfer Tavern are delighted at the prospect of his potential signing. Undoubtedly one of the Premier League’s most solid central defenders, Dijk has become a wall in the heart of the Saints’ defence – and he would undoubtedly improve Liverpool’s somewhat shaky defence.
With Sakho seemingly on the way out, and James Milner currently being played out of position – both Liverpool’s central defence and left-back spots need reinforcement in January – and these 2 certainly fit the bill.
The Southampton fans in the Football Transfer Tavern are very disappointed about this, as van Dijk, in particular, is one of their most important players. Since signing in 2015 from Celtic, he has formed the cornerstone of the Southampton defence – and he would be a huge loss should he depart.
